Title: Quality assurance of product sorting and packaging: a project-based approach to mitigate errors and enhance accuracy

Abstract: Achieving operational excellence, reliably meeting customer demands, accurate product sorting and packaging processes, this entails implementing robust quality control and assurance measures, automated sorting systems, and comprehensive checks. Our research-study focuses on addressing sorting and packaging errors in a manufacturing company through a project-based approach. The current sorting machine's sole reliance on reading product labels leads to mixing and exchanging errors. To overcome this challenge, we propose developing a software solution with a new feature: the ability to read labels and detect box colours. This enhancement significantly improves reliability and accuracy in product identification and sorting. Introducing colour-coded boxes enables the machine to easily differentiate between products, reducing incorrect sorting and ensuring precision. This approach creates a seamless system that streamlines operations, enhances quality, prevents customer returns, and maximises customer satisfaction.
